Did You Know: Not All Crematories Keep Pet Remains Separate
In the pet cremation industry, there is often a troubling lack of transparency. Some providers cut corners by performing communal or batch cremations, where multiple animals are cremated together. The result? Ashes can be mixed, and families may unknowingly receive a blend of remains—or none of their pet’s at all. This practice isn’t just heartbreaking—it’s deceptive. A 2019 investigative report by the Cremation Association of North America (CANA) revealed that nearly 40% of pet crematories lacked clearly defined protocols to ensure individual pet identification throughout the cremation process

Cremated Ashes Aren’t Good for Plants or Soil
Many pet parents dream of returning their beloved companions to the earth—scattering ashes under a favorite tree, in a backyard garden, or across the prairie. But few realize that cremated remains, despite being called “ashes,” are not soil-friendly.
Flame cremation doesn’t produce soft ash like a campfire. Instead, it creates bone fragments that are processed into a fine, chalky substance known as cremains. These cremains are highly alkaline

Cremation Relies on Fossil Fuels: A Cost We Can No Longer Afford
Flame cremation requires extreme heat—typically 1,400 to 1,800 degrees Fahrenheit. To maintain these temperatures, crematories use significant amounts of non-renewable fossil fuels like natural gas or propane. According to the National Renewable Energy Laboratory (2021), a single cremation consumes enough fuel to power the average home for 3 to 4 days. Multiply that across the country’s estimated 1.6 million pet cremations annually, and the environmental cost becomes staggering.

A Brief History of Urns: From Ancient Traditions to Modern Memorials
One of the earliest known uses of urns dates back to the Bronze Age (3300-1200 BCE), where archaeological findings reveal that people from ancient China, Greece, and Rome used urns to hold cremated remains. In ancient Greece, urns, or lekythos, were used in funeral rites and often adorned with depictions of mourning scenes or mythological stories

The Environmental Impact and Health Concerns of Flame-Based Cremation
Flame-based cremation, while initially introduced as a sanitary alternative to burial, carries significant environmental and health concerns. The process involves burning the body at high temperatures, which releases harmful pollutants like carbon dioxide (CO2), mercury from dental fillings, and dioxins into the atmosphere. These emissions contribute to air pollution and climate change. A single cremation can emit up to 400 kg of CO2, comparable to a 500-mile car trip

A Brief History of Flame-Based Cremation in America
Flame-based cremation, also known as traditional cremation, has a relatively recent history in America, with its roots in the late 19th century. The practice of cremation was introduced in the United States in 1876 when Dr. Julius LeMoyne, a physician and social reformer, built the first crematory in Washington, Pennsylvania. Dr. LeMoyne was influenced by growing concerns about public health
